Output 43e850fee0410f616419c3acd2c7f46d80b8982c1988b54c25d858889faf5b27:1

value
15338116
script pubkey
OP_0 OP_PUSHBYTES_20 1d8acc46ae9cb69e54d70b3b0f1f2e7c88806c8d
address
tb1qrk9vc34wnjmfu4xhpvas78ew0jygqmyd973tfg
transaction
43e850fee0410f616419c3acd2c7f46d80b8982c1988b54c25d858889faf5b27